I was able to get the Sword of Storm Shadow and Sword of Snake Eyes for pretty cheap recently and this just arrived today so I took her out for some pics. The Sword of Snake Eyes is on the way and I'll do the same when it arrives.

The box is bright with a lot of graphics including a mini bio of Storm Shadow on the back along with the picture that was on the original SS cardback.

It comes nicely and securely boxed.

The handle is all white and features 2 cobras facing opposite directions.

The Tsuba also features the cutout of the Cobra logo.

It is actually a very balanced sword. Much more balanced than the UC LOTR swords. It is also VERY sharp. While the blade is advertised as white powdercoated. The cutting edge is uncoated so half of the blade is white and the other half is steel. I would have preferred one or the other, all white or all steel.
